Who We Are:
Our mission is to create a culture of responsibility and awareness on the road. We are devoted to making the journey to and from school safer. We develop partnerships, deploy Safety Tech and manage the entire program. We have equipped thousands of buses across North America with our innovative technology and we continue to educate tens of thousands of drivers a month on safety. BusPatrol America cares about student safety. We educate motorists every day by helping to enforce the law and work with school officials to improve safety.
The Opportunity:
Reporting to the DevOps Team Lead, the successful candidates will be instrumental in helping to build, test, and maintain the infrastructure and tools to allow for the speedy development and release of software and updates. We need a team of dedicated, agile, and creative DevOps Engineers to identify and analyze our development processes to support our rapid growth.
What we need you to do:
- Maintaining cloud services and highly available, auto scaling infrastructure in AWS
- Support security tool implementation and monitoring
- Run security scanning and manage SIEM software(s) or service providers
- Establish and perform maintenance programs following industry best practices.
- Participate in and contribute to the planning and execution of business continuity and disaster recovery capabilities.
- Research new service integrations both internal to AWS and external
- Develop Proof of Concepts for new security initiatives
What you bring:
- 3-5 Years of hands-on experience with AWS services and products (EC2, ECS, SQS, RDS, Cloudwatch, Guard Duty)
- Ability to provide technical leadership to developers for designing and securing solutions
- Experience with scripting languages such as Python
- Understanding of Linux utilities and Bash
- Familiarity of containerization with Docker
- Experience in Lambda, SQS, Batch, ALB/NLBs, SNS, and S3 (preferred)
- Security compliance and scans (preferred)
- Deep knowledge of DNS and routing (preferred)
- Experience with AWS Fargate Serverless Computing Engine (preferred)

The Opportunity:
Reporting to the Sr. Software Development Lead, the successful candidates will be instrumental in executing and delivering well tested code. This position will require you to work in close concert, as part of a larger geographically distant team where you will be required to share your insights to drive a better process.
What we need you to do:
- Design, build, and maintain efficient, reusable, and tested code
- Contribute in all phases of the development lifecycle
- Be a productive member of an inclusive team where pairing and peer reviewed code are valued
- Follow best practices (continuous integration, SCRUM, refactoring, and code standards)
- Drive continuous adoption and integration of relevant new technologies into design
- Engineer documented, scalable, and secure APIs from deprecated legacy code
What you bring:
- 3+ years Ruby development experience
- 3+ years of experience with Ruby web frameworks(ex: Rails or Rack)
- Proven work experience in a software development team
- Demonstrable knowledge of front-end technologies such as JavaScript, HTML5, CSS3
- Passion for writing great, simple, clean, efficient code
- Workable knowledge of relational databases(ex: MySQL, Postgres)
- BS/MS degree in Computer Science or equivalent experience
- Knowledge of version control, such as Git
Preferred Experience:
- Vue.js and Jest testing framework
- SASS experience
- IoT Technologies
- Familiarity with Docker
- Use of code quality tools (ex: RuboCop)
